The Committee discussed Ditch Invert Policy. It was agreed
that the taxpayer will pay for the installation of the concrete
invert. Mr. Bertram will use his discretion regarding the
billing of the taxpayers but also bring it before this Committee. Motion was made to approve the policy by Aid;-Debgelis
and seconded by Ald. Dumke. Motion carried.
